Drupal

Drupal 7.32 released

drupal.org - Wed, 2014-10-15 07:47

Drupal 7.32, a maintenance release which contain fixes for security vulnerabilities, is now available for download. See the Drupal 7.32 release notes for further information.

Download Drupal 7.32

Upgrading your existing Drupal 7 is strongly recommended. There are no new features or non-security-related bug fixes in this release. For more information about the Drupal 7.x release series, consult the Drupal 7.0 release announcement.

Security information

We have a security announcement mailing list and a history of all security advisories, as well as an RSS feed with the most recent security advisories. We strongly advise Drupal administrators to sign up for the list.

Drupal 7 and 6 include the built-in Update Status module (renamed to Update Manager in Drupal 7), which informs you about important updates to your modules and themes.

Bug reports

Both Drupal 7.x and 6.x are being maintained, so given enough bug fixes (not just bug reports) more maintenance releases will be made available, according to our monthly release cycle.

Changelog

Drupal 7.32 is a security release only. For more details, see the 7.32 release notes. A complete list of all bug fixes in the stable 7.x branch can be found in the git commit log.

Security vulnerabilities

Drupal 7.32 was released in response to the discovery of critical security vulnerabilities. Details can be found in the official security advisory:

To fix the security problem, please upgrade to Drupal 7.32.

Known issues

None.

Front page news: Planet DrupalDrupal version: Drupal 7.x
Categories: Drupal

Drupal 8.0.0 beta 1 released

drupal.org - Wed, 2014-10-01 01:30

Drupal 8.0.0-beta1 has just been released for testing and feedback! This key milestone is the work of over 2,300 people who have contributed more than 11,500 committed patches to 15 alpha releases, and especially the 234 contributors who fixed 177 "beta blocker" issues. To read about the new features in Drupal 8, see Drupal.org's Drupal 8 landing page.

Drupal 8 beta 1 for testers

Betas are good testing targets for developers and site builders who are comfortable reporting (and where possible, fixing) their own bugs, and who are prepared to rebuild their test sites from scratch if necessary. Beta releases are not recommended for non-technical users, nor for production websites.

Start by downloading Drupal 8.0.0-beta 1 and installing it! Drupal 8 definitely still has bugs, and we need your help to discover them. Let us know what bugs you find in the Drupal core issue queue. (Please search the known issues before filing.)

Drupal 8 beta 1 for module and core developers

The main differences between the previous Drupal 8 alphas and the new beta are:

  • The fundamental APIs in Drupal 8 (like the entity, configuration, and menu APIs) are now stable enough so that contributed module and theme authors can start (or resume) their #D8CX pledges and port their projects to Drupal 8.
  • We have locked down Drupal 8's data model enough that developers should generally not need to perform data migrations between beta releases of Drupal 8. We will start providing a beta-to-beta upgrade path in a later beta release.
  • Limited API and data model changes will still happen, though core maintainers will try to isolate these changes to only non-fundamental APIs or critical bug fixes.

We need your help to fix critical bugs by reviewing patches and creating patches.

If you're new to core development, check out Core contribution mentoring, a twice-weekly IRC meeting where you can get one-on-one help getting set up and finding a Drupal 8 task.

Drupal 8 beta 1 for designers, translators, and documentation writers

Drupal 8's user interface, interface text, and markup are not finalized until the first release candidate, so it's too early to focus on user-facing documentation, translations, or themes (though by all means, adventurous contributors should start now to provide feedback while we can still fix things). Note that localize.drupal.org does not yet support the full Drupal 8 API and does not have all translatable strings.

When does 8.0.0 get released?

Beta 1 will be followed by a series of additional beta releases with bug fixes, performance improvements, and improved stability.

The release version of Drupal 8.0.0 will be ready after there are no more critical issues (as of today, there are 97 remaining) and we've had at least one release candidate (RC) without adding any more critical issues to the list.

When will that be? "When it's ready." The more people help, the faster we can find and fix bugs, and the faster 8.0.0 gets released. The faster 8.0.0 gets released, the faster we can start adding new features for Drupal 8.1.0. So help out where you can, and let's deliver the best release of Drupal ever! :)

Thank you!

A massive thank-you to everyone who helped get Drupal 8 beta 1 done, especially the contributors who have focused on beta-blocking issues (pictured below).

Front page news: Planet DrupalDrupal version: Drupal 8.x
Categories: Drupal

Drupal.org Maintenance: Sep 23rd 14:00 PDT (21:00 UTC)

drupal.org - Mon, 2014-09-22 15:50

Drupal.org will be affected by maintenance Tuesday, September 23rd 14:00 PDT, 21:00 UTC.

Switching version control systems for Drupal.org deployment will cause a short downtime as docroot files are migrated. We plan on a 30 minute window of potential instability.

Please follow the @drupal_infra Twitter account for any issues encountered during the maintenance window.

Thanks for your patience!

Categories: Drupal

Drupal Security Team update.

drupal.org - Thu, 2014-09-18 13:07
Joint Security release with WordPress

In big news, we had our first joint release with WordPress. We collaborated together with the WordPress team on a PHP security issue discovered by a security researcher. We’re thrilled that we had an opportunity to work together with others in the open source CMS community. We shared a few tips and tricks and it was great working with the WordPress team.

Keeping Drupal Secure

In keeping with our mission to showcase security best practices at Drupal’s online home, we’ve upgraded https://security.drupal.org to Drupal 7. This ensures we’re on a supported platform. We also took the opportunity to add some new features that help us enhance our team’s efficiency by automating a number of routine tasks.

As part of our dedication to keeping Drupal users safe, we’ve written and announced the Long Term support (LTS) plan for Drupal 6 (https://www.drupal.org/d6-lts-support). This is an important step as we look forward to the release of Drupal 8. Soon we will be introducing two-factor authentication to Drupal.org, thanks to hard work from security team members Ben Jeavons, Greg Knaddison , Neil Drumm, and Michael Hess. (https://groups.drupal.org/node/439868 and https://drupal.org/node/2239973)

And here’s one last, fun note: Security.Drupal.org issues now show up on the drupal.org dashboard if you add the widget. You can get it clicking on dashboard after logging in and adding the widget.


Securing Drupal E-Commerce

Some Drupal security team members were recently involved in putting together a compliance White paper for keeping track of PCI compliance. Anyone who runs a Drupal site and takes credit cards should read the whitepaper. Here’s a little more information:

Version 3.0 of the PCI compliance standard becomes mandatory on January 1st, 2015 and will be a complete game changer for many Drupal eCommerce sites. This includes triple the number of security controls if your website touches credit card information and more. The community supported Drupal PCI Compliance White Paper (http://drupalpcicompliance.org/) will give you a high level overview of what PCI compliance is, why you need to comply, and (most importantly) how to get started. This paper was written and reviewed by several members of the Drupal security team, including Rick Manelius, Greg Knaddison, Ned McClain, Michael Hess, and Peter Wolanin.

Simplifying Security

We’ve redesigned our Security Advisory system to make evaluating and analyzing security threats easier and more intuitive. This came about after several core contributors informed us that they wanted a better way to address security threats. We sent out a survey through Twitter to learn more about how people write and read the Security Advisories. Based on the responses we put together a new Security Advisory system that takes much of the guesswork out of the process of evaluating threats. We’ve added and reordered elements on the Security Advisory’s criticality scale and added explanations to help people understand where a security problem is on the spectrum of potential threats.

Our Growing Team

We’ve brought a number of new members onto the security team. Please help us give a very warm welcome to our newest security team members:

Alex Pott (alexpott) - IRC nick: alexpott, Organization: Chapter Three
Cash Williams (cashwilliams) - IRC nick: CashWilliams, Organization: Acquia
Dan Smith (galooph) - IRC nick: galooph, Organization: Code Enigma
David Snopek (dsnopek) - IRC nick: dsnopek, Organization: MVPcreator
Rick Manelius (rickmanelius) - IRC nick: rickmanelius, Organization: NewMedia!

We’re always looking for more qualified people who place a high priority on security. If you’d like to join the security team: https://security.drupal.org/join

Drupal version: Drupal 7.x
Categories: Drupal

Drupal.org Maintenance: Sep 16th 16:00 PDT (23:00 UTC)

drupal.org - Mon, 2014-09-15 17:34

Drupal.org will be affected by maintenance Tuesday, September 16th 16:00 PDT, 23:00 UTC.

A regular module update will alter some larger tables, which will block other queries. We plan on up to 30 minutes of downtime while these updates run.

Please follow the @drupal_infra Twitter account for any issues encountered during the maintenance window.

Thanks for your patience!

Front page news: Drupal News
Categories: Drupal

Maintainers can give credit to organizations that support Drupal projects

drupal.org - Wed, 2014-08-27 23:09

This week, we added a feature to projects on Drupal.org to help highlight the contributions made by supporting organizations. Maintainers of distributions, modules, and themes can give credit to organizations that have materially contributed to projects on Drupal.org using the new “Supporting Organizations” field.

How do you use this field? When an organization funds the development of a project or when a company takes on maintainership of a key module in the community, the maintainers of that project can add a reference to one or more of them on the project node. Maintainers may chose to give this credit to any organization that contributes significant code or support to a project.

We noticed that many projects would manually follow this pattern in the project description, but wanted to take it a step further. Not only will this provide a link to the organization, it will also show up on the organization’s marketplace page.

This is just the first step, we are also looking for community feedback and help in providing credit to companies, organizations and customers that contribute to the development of Drupal. Implementing this step will be a key way to show how organizations are giving code and support to Drupal Core. Look for it in the coming months.

Dries has written an excellent post on how we might give credit to organizations and another on the value of hiring a core contributor to help push Drupal forward that were a basis for much of this work.

If you are a project maintainer, take a moment to give some credit to the organizations that have helped build the Drupal ecosystem.

Front page news: Drupal News
Categories: Drupal

Introducing Drupal.org Terms of Service and Privacy Policy

drupal.org - Fri, 2014-08-08 08:50

Almost half a year ago, with the help of the Drupal.org Content Working Group and lawyers, the Drupal Association started working on a Drupal.org Terms of Service (ToS) and Privacy Policy. After a number of drafts and rewrites, we are now ready to introduce both documents to Drupal.org users.

Why do we need a ToS?

Drupal.org has grown organically for many years. Currently the site has thousands of active users that generate lots of content every day. Our current Terms of Service are limited to a short line on the account creation form:

“Please note: All user accounts are for individuals. Accounts created for more than one user or those using anonymous mail services will be blocked when discovered.”

This line is an insufficient ToS for a website of our size. In fact, Drupal.org is probably the only website of this size which operates without a published Terms of Service. This situation is uncomfortable, and even dangerous, for both Drupal community and the Drupal Association, which is legally responsible for Drupal.org and its contents.

In the absence of a ToS, a lot of rules—“do’s and don’ts”—regarding the website are just “common knowledge” of users who have a long memory and accounts created in the early days of Drupal.org. This might result in new users making mistakes and misbehaving only because they do not know what the unwritten rules are. Website moderators often lack guidance on how to react in specific situations, because those policies are not written anywhere. Some policies, such as organization accounts policy or account deletion policy still need to be defined. Lastly, absence of clearly defined Terms of Service and Privacy Policy could lead to legal disputes regarding the site.

What’s next?

The new Drupal.org Terms of Service and Privacy Policy are published now for the community review. We'll continue refining them based on community feedback and announce the 'official' implementation day additionally. On that day all existing users will have to accept these ToS and Privacy Policy to continue using the website. All new users starting on that day will have to accept the ToS and Privacy Policy upon account creation.

Click to review Drupal.org Terms of Service

Click to review Drupal.org Privacy Policy

In the future, we will make sure to keep ToS and Privacy Policy up-to-date and update them every time policies or functionality of the website changes. We will proactively notify users of all modifications to both documents.

Thanks

We’d like to say thanks to the Drupal.org Content Working Group members and community members who already reviewed proposed documents and provided us with their valuable feedback.

UPDATE: Edits to the original drafts were made on 21st of August, 2014, based on feedback in comments to this post.

UPDATE #2 (03.09.2014): We are postponing ToS/PP official launch and will come back with an updated draft shortly.

Categories: Drupal

Drupal 7.31 and 6.33 released

drupal.org - Wed, 2014-08-06 12:35

Update: Drupal 7.32 is now available.

Drupal 7.31 and Drupal 6.33, maintenance releases which contain fixes for security vulnerabilities, are now available for download. See the Drupal 7.31 and Drupal 6.33 release notes for further information.

Download Drupal 7.31
Download Drupal 6.33

Upgrading your existing Drupal 7 and 6 sites is strongly recommended. There are no new features or non-security-related bug fixes in these releases. For more information about the Drupal 7.x release series, consult the Drupal 7.0 release announcement. More information on the Drupal 6.x release series can be found in the Drupal 6.0 release announcement.

Security information

We have a security announcement mailing list and a history of all security advisories, as well as an RSS feed with the most recent security advisories. We strongly advise Drupal administrators to sign up for the list.

Drupal 7 and 6 include the built-in Update Status module (renamed to Update Manager in Drupal 7), which informs you about important updates to your modules and themes.

Bug reports

Both Drupal 7.x and 6.x are being maintained, so given enough bug fixes (not just bug reports) more maintenance releases will be made available, according to our monthly release cycle.

Changelog

Drupal 7.31 is a security release only. For more details, see the 7.31 release notes. A complete list of all bug fixes in the stable 7.x branch can be found in the git commit log.

Drupal 6.33 is a security release only. For more details, see the 6.33 release notes. A complete list of all bug fixes in the stable 6.x branch can be found in the git commit log.

Security vulnerabilities

Drupal 7.31 and 6.33 were released in response to the discovery of security vulnerabilities. Details can be found in the official security advisory:

To fix the security problem, please upgrade to either Drupal 7.31 or Drupal 6.33.

Update notes

See the 7.31 and 6.33 release notes for details on important changes in this release.

Known issues

None.

Front page news: Planet DrupalDrupal version: Drupal 6.xDrupal 7.x
Categories: Drupal

Drupal 7.30 released

drupal.org - Thu, 2014-07-24 17:12

Update: Drupal 7.31 is now available.

Drupal 7.30, a maintenance release with several bug fixes (no security fixes), including a fix for regressions introduced in Drupal 7.29, is now available for download. See the Drupal 7.30 release notes for a full listing.

Download Drupal 7.30

Upgrading your existing Drupal 7 sites is recommended. There are no new features in this release. For more information about the Drupal 7.x release series, consult the Drupal 7.0 release announcement.

Security information

We have a security announcement mailing list and a history of all security advisories, as well as an RSS feed with the most recent security advisories. We strongly advise Drupal administrators to sign up for the list.

Drupal 7 includes the built-in Update Manager module, which informs you about important updates to your modules and themes.

There are no security fixes in this release of Drupal core.

Bug reports

Drupal 7.x is being maintained, so given enough bug fixes (not just bug reports), more maintenance releases will be made available, according to our monthly release cycle.

Changelog

Drupal 7.30 is a bug fix only release. The full list of changes between the 7.29 and 7.30 releases can be found by reading the 7.30 release notes. A complete list of all bug fixes in the stable 7.x branch can be found in the git commit log.

Update notes

See the 7.30 release notes for details on important changes in this release.

Known issues

None.

Front page news: Planet DrupalDrupal version: Drupal 7.x
Categories: Drupal

Drupal 7.29 and 6.32 released

drupal.org - Wed, 2014-07-16 15:37

Update: Drupal 7.30 and Drupal 6.33 are now available.

Drupal 7.29 and Drupal 6.32, maintenance releases which contain fixes for security vulnerabilities, are now available for download. See the Drupal 7.29 and Drupal 6.32 release notes for further information.

Download Drupal 7.29
Download Drupal 6.32

Upgrading your existing Drupal 7 and 6 sites is strongly recommended. There are no new features or non-security-related bug fixes in these releases. For more information about the Drupal 7.x release series, consult the Drupal 7.0 release announcement. More information on the Drupal 6.x release series can be found in the Drupal 6.0 release announcement.

Security information

We have a security announcement mailing list and a history of all security advisories, as well as an RSS feed with the most recent security advisories. We strongly advise Drupal administrators to sign up for the list.

Drupal 7 and 6 include the built-in Update Status module (renamed to Update Manager in Drupal 7), which informs you about important updates to your modules and themes.

Bug reports

Both Drupal 7.x and 6.x are being maintained, so given enough bug fixes (not just bug reports) more maintenance releases will be made available, according to our monthly release cycle.

Changelog

Drupal 7.29 is a security release only. For more details, see the 7.29 release notes. A complete list of all bug fixes in the stable 7.x branch can be found in the git commit log.

Drupal 6.32 is a security release only. For more details, see the 6.32 release notes. A complete list of all bug fixes in the stable 6.x branch can be found in the git commit log.

Security vulnerabilities

Drupal 7.29 and 6.32 were released in response to the discovery of security vulnerabilities. Details can be found in the official security advisory:

To fix the security problem, please upgrade to either Drupal 7.29 or Drupal 6.32.

Known issues

(Drupal 7 only) This release introduced a serious regression, the biggest effect of which is to cause files or images attached to taxonomy terms to be deleted when the taxonomy term is edited and resaved. See the release notes for more details. The solution is to upgrade to Drupal 7.30 or higher.

Front page news: Planet DrupalDrupal version: Drupal 6.xDrupal 7.x
Categories: Drupal
Syndicate content